@Generated(value="OracleSDKGenerator", comments="API Version: 20250320") public final class UpdateMacOrderDetails extends com.oracle.bmc.http.client.internal.ExplicitlySetBmcModel
The data to update a MacOrder.
Note: Objects should always be created or deserialized using the UpdateMacOrderDetails.Builder
. This model
distinguishes fields that are null
because they are unset from fields that are explicitly
set to null
. This is done in the setter methods of the UpdateMacOrderDetails.Builder
, which maintain a
set of all explicitly set fields called UpdateMacOrderDetails.Builder.__explicitlySet__
. The hashCode()
and equals(Object)
methods are implemented to take the explicitly set
fields into account. The constructor, on the other hand, does not take the explicitly set fields
into account (since the constructor cannot distinguish explicit null
from unset null
).
